Today’s Project Management Global briefing: Pipelines Don’t Deliver Projects

Governments love a big number. This week the UK unveiled a £700bn-plus infrastructure pipeline, the sort of figure designed to signal ambition and momentum. But project professionals know a pipeline is not delivery; it is intent - wherever you are in the world.

History offers a sobering reminder. A significant share of previously announced infrastructure spending never materialises in the form originally promised. Projects stall in planning, funding shifts with political cycles, and priorities quietly change. The result is a landscape full of announcements but thinner on completed assets.

For project managers, the lesson is familiar. Delivery depends less on the scale of the promise and more on the discipline behind it; stable funding, realistic timelines, skilled teams, and political consistency.

Ambition matters. Infrastructure pipelines matter. But until plans turn into contracts, cranes, and concrete, they remain what they have always been: potential rather than progress. We hope, for the sector across the world, these promises actually do deliver more opportunities for us all.
